Lead legal strategy at the Port of Prince Rupert as the Director of Legal Services. This role emphasizes compliance, risk management, and supports organizational goals through comprehensive legal guidance.
Reporting to the Vice President, Communications and General Counsel, you'll provide crucial legal services across departments. As a key leader, you will engage with corporate strategies, manage legal risks, and ensure compliance with all relevant regulations. Your expertise will encompass contract negotiation, Indigenous affairs, and corporate governance to drive strategic decision-making.
Key Responsibilities:
• Provide legal support for corporate and operational departments
• Negotiate and draft commercial agreements including leases
• Advise on Indigenous consultation and agreements
• Identify legal issues and develop mitigation strategies
• Prepare Board materials and legal opinions
Requirements:
• Bachelor of Law Degree and Law Society membership
• 7+ years of corporate/commercial legal experience
• Experience in contract negotiation and lease documentation
• Solid legal research and communication skills
• Proven ability to manage multiple projects effectively
